Advertising Web Services provides you nothing. You will need to set up the Google AdWords account yourself. Their $75 credit is BS as Google offers you a $75 voucher after you pay the first $25 yourself. You will need to manage your campaign b/c Advertising Web Services won't even bother looking over your website and apply effective search tags. They tell you to "let it run for a while." Also, BEWARE, if you ever want to delete your Google AdWords account, you won't be able to b/c Advertising Web Services sets themselves up as the administrator. You'll go through hell trying to get their attention and removing your account through Google.

Their ad popped up while I was logged into Google Adwords, as a site that would help you write and place your website's adwords ad. They claim you get a 14 day trial for $5 and that they will help you write your ad. Since I THOUGHT it was sponsored by Google (being it popped up while I was in my account info while I was logged into Google), I thought what the heck. Then they IMMEDIATELY charged my Credit card, not for $5 but TWICE for $69.99. THIS IS A FRAUD and a SCAMMER! PLEASE STAY AWAY! Now I have to dispute and cancel my credit card.
